HOSPITALS RETURN.

Notɛ.—On the first occasion of filling up these forms, a play of each floor of the hospital should be sent home. Each such plan should be the size of the Blue Book sheet. In subsequent years, if there has been no material alteration in the buildings, or addition to them, it will be sufficient to refer to the Blue Book in which the plans were sent home.

If the buildings are afterwards altered or enlarged, fresh plans should be sent home with the Blue Book of the year in which the alterations were effertel.
